Comment: I maximize my time sightseeing when I travel, so all I want is a clean well lit place to sleep, shower, dress, and defecate. Hotel Champ-de-mars meets these minimum requirements. Hotel is near the waterfront, Chinatown, old town, downtown, McGill University and a hill overlooking city; a great location. Staff is reserved. When a friend came later, we got a larger (but tiny) room easily. A complementary real breakfast (pancakes, eggs, French toast, coffee, juices, etc) was served with class. Hotel has no frills, a simple bar and restaurant, but is the place to stay if you stay away.

Comment: The Champ-de-Mars is a charming hotel at the edge of Old Montreal. It is just three blocks from the Metro (subway) and a short walk from the Palais-de-Congres (convention center). Location and price were my main criteria, as I am a grad student (read: poor!) and was in Montreal for a conference. The Champ-de-Mars did not disappoint and, in fact, it was better than I had expected! A hearty breakfast was included--guests can choose any of six options. I will definitely consider this hotel for my next trip.

Comment: Rooms are unimaginably tiny. The "suite" they gave us was very tiny, and we literally fell through one of the beds. When we complained about our first room we had(the suite), the manager literally said, "you think that room is bad, wait until you see our other rooms". The manager always played it off as being "european style", as if saying, it's not something us americans would understand. Taking all your bags up the flight of stairs on the 3rd floor gets annoying, needs an elevator. In addition, you need 3 keys: one to enter the hotel, one to enter the stairway, and one to enter your room.
